Early Career Breakthrough and Earnings
The initial commercial surge came with the 13th Floor Elevators, generating label advances, session fees, and early performance income. However, legal troubles and health issues quickly curtailed consistent revenue streams, creating early volatility in net worth.
Health Challenges and Financial Strain
Decades of institutionalization and treatment imposed substantial costs, often covered by limited public support and family resources. Medical priorities frequently outweighed potential earnings, flattening what could have been a more robust financial profile.
